Wikipedia article'Un beso en el puerto' is a 1965 Spanish motion picture. The film was directed by Ramn Torrado, and stars Manolo Escobar, Ingrid Pitt, Antonio Ferrandis, Mara Isbert and Manuel Alexandre. PlotBenidorm, 1960s. Manolo, a gas station employee, is fired from his job by his excessive fondness for singing. He meets an old friend, Jaime, who lives like a Prince and always accompanied by the tourists more beautiful who spend the summer in those beaches, and tells Manolo trick he uses to conquer them. Taking advantage of the absence of his friend, wears his clothes and puts into practice the trick. This consists of the port of Alicante and approaching the first handsome traveler that landing, hug her warmly and say: "Welcome, Dorothy!". Then, under the pretext of the confusion begins the friendship. Cast* Manolo Escobar * Ingrid Pitt as Dorothy * Antonio Ferrandis * Mara Isbert * Manuel Alexandre | |
